Por que você deve usar o Solidity para o desenvolvimento de Blockchain

Por que você deve usar o Solidity para o desenvolvimento de Blockchain

Solidity é uma linguagem de programação orientada a objetos baseada em Ethereum. Veja por que você deve usá-lo para o desenvolvimento de blockchain.

Imagem em destaque

US$ 39 bilhões até 2025. E esse número só vai aumentar após a implementação da Web 3.0.

Web 3.0 é a terceira iteração do desenvolvimento web. É uma evolução descentralizada das tecnologias da web e é chamada de “a Internet do futuro” pelas massas. Ele dá forte ênfase ao desenvolvimento descentralizado de aplicativos e ao design web baseado em blockchain. O Solidity está a caminho de ser uma grande parte do desenvolvimento de aplicativos Web 3.0 devido à sua capacidade de criar (e implementar) contratos inteligentes em diferentes plataformas.

O que os iniciantes devem saber sobre o desenvolvimento do Solidity?

Qualquer pessoa que esteja começando no Solidity deve saber que os contratos inteligentes são imutáveis ​​(ou seja, você não pode alterá-los após a implantação). Não há margem para erros ao criar tais contratos, uma vez que as transações não podem ser revertidas. Isso também significa que erros na criação de tais contratos expõem seus clientes a lacunas jurídicas e financeiras.

No entanto, esta funcionalidade também pode ser útil para estabelecer confiança e determinar a legitimidade de contratos inteligentes. Depois que um contrato é assinado, você pode ter certeza de que seus protocolos não serão alterados, a menos que seu código subjacente seja alterado, o que requer a autoridade de ambas as partes signatárias.

Os iniciantes também devem ter em mente problemas de loop e cálculos durante o desenvolvimento. Os cálculos no Ethereum são caros. Você tem que pagar taxas de gás para cada etapa computacional executada e os contratos do Solidity podem exigir muitas etapas. Essas etapas também podem se tornar alvo de hackers, pois eles podem explorá-las para criar falsos problemas de DOS. Portanto, os iniciantes no Solidity devem sempre ter em mente os problemas de loop e as taxas de gás ao criar contratos de blockchain.

Fonte: BairesDev

Conteúdo Relacionado

A Infineon Technologies AG apresenta os novos MOSFETs CoolSiC...
Uma rede de sensores é incorporada em todos os...
O controlador do motor é um dos componentes mais...
ESP32-CAM é um módulo de câmera compacto que combina...
A Arctic Semiconductor revelou o SilverWings. Representando um avanço...
A evolução dos padrões USB foi fundamental para moldar...
A SCHURTER anuncia um aprimoramento para sua conhecida série...
A Sealevel Systems anuncia o lançamento da Interface Serial...
A STMicroelectronics introduziu Diodos retificadores Schottky de trincheira de...
Determinar uma localização precisa é necessário em várias indústrias...
O novo VIPerGaN50 da STMicroelectronics simplifica a construção de...
A GenAI está transformando a força de trabalho com...
Entenda o papel fundamental dos testes unitários na validação...
Aprenda como os testes de carga garantem que seu...
Aprofunde-se nas funções complementares dos testes positivos e negativos...
Powrót do blogu

Zostaw komentarz

Pamiętaj, że komentarze muszą zostać zatwierdzone przed ich opublikowaniem.